They say the lake answers when the moon burns blue.

In the shadowed water of Llyn Du, hydrologist Talise Calder comes searching for scientific truthโ€”and finds a man shaped from water, memory, and an ancient sorrow. When a red thread of fate binds them together, a quiet, aching love begins to surface.

But the lake does not remain still. As its waters rise and old vows stir beneath the surface, Talise is drawn into a bond that defies time and asks for sacrifice, yet never demands what love should not freely give.

To choose him is to step into a destiny woven by Ariandwyn, the ancient goddess who waits between hill and sea and remembers every promise spoken at the waterโ€™s edge.

Tender and haunting, Still Waters, Deep is a standalone novel in the Between Hill and Sea series, steeped in Welsh folkloreโ€”where love is gentle, magic is old, and the waters remember every name.

The 15th April is National Laverbread Day, a wonderful celebration of one of Wales's most beloved and distinctive delicacies. Laverbread, made from seaweed harvested along the Welsh coastline, has been a part of Welsh culture for centuries, and it feels like a quietly perfect little date to mark given the coastal heart of so much of my writing.
